The Graphical User Interface Concern = The LML DSL
Demonstration based on this application example
The DSLs used for the GUI application:
The LML language definition with the AbSynt DSL
lml.absynt
The LML component description with the CDML DSL
lml.cdml
The GUI component description with the CDML DSL
glayout.cdml
The business code (written by hand):
An XSLT transformation
lml2bml.xsl
Graphical objects:
Frame, Split, Set, View
Some methods for LML component:
Lml.java
Prev
Next
Didier.Parigot@inria.fr SmartTools demonstration at GPCE'04 October (gui)